16.1 FNC 80 – RS / Serial Communication
16.1
FNC 80 – RS / Serial Communication
Outline
This instruction sends and receives data using non-protocol communication by way of a serial port (only ch1) in
accordance with RS-232C or RS-485 provided in the main unit.

Explanation of function and operation
1. 16-bit operation (RS)
This instruction sends and receives data in non-protocol communication by way of serial ports in accordance with 
RS-232C or RS-485 provided in the main unit.
→ For detailed explanation, refer to the Data Communication Edition manual.
